Output 91bfe61327466db6a14d6c04c870f0d28073af0fe281743f0471a53e565f27e5:4

value
41315751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f96f5e5a4806005a8b74359524bd28142d20b55 OP_EQUAL
address
MDhPeSKc2rkFhNPexsmivDZPiCYNLqTygz
transaction
91bfe61327466db6a14d6c04c870f0d28073af0fe281743f0471a53e565f27e5
spent
true